Transaction f66603697c51077c49f79a7a6ad7b8796dbbdf411accd3381bc1d2edc5108858
1 Input
1 Output
-
f66603697c51077c49f79a7a6ad7b8796dbbdf411accd3381bc1d2edc5108858:0
- value
- 99086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40f23ac00acc9855cfb1e5bb12f197bd429c7234 OP_EQUAL
- address
- 37cRMDn6gujWbUj4XAMrgBKJjPwYHEq6eM